Repair of windows made of UPVC

uPVC (polyvinyl chloride that has not been plasticized) is a well-liked material for window frames because of its durability and low maintenance requirements. It is also a budget-friendly material. Unlike wood or aluminum, upvc window repairs leeds will not warp or fade, nor will it rot. It is also easy to clean and just click the next document is impervious to moisture. uPVC is also easy to mold into complex forms, which makes it ideal for window frames that have an exact fit.

It is possible to repair the condition of a UPVC window that has double glazing without the need to replace it. Most of the time, the issue is simply a damaged hinge or lock. In these instances an expert can replace the handle, hinges or locks to restore functionality of the window. It is also worth checking whether the windows have an outer seal that blocks water from entering. If not, you may be able to get in touch with an uPVC expert.

Another problem that is commonly encountered with uPVC windows is condensation between the glass panes. This is caused by a breakdown in the double glazing seal. In most instances, this can be repaired, however if water is leaking from the window into your home it might require replacement.

A uPVC window installer can upgrade your windows to incorporate energy-saving features. They can install argon-filled units with thermal spacers in order to reduce energy loss and save money on heating expenses.
